Understanding Hard Money Lending: A Comprehensive Guide

properties

Hard money lending is a financial solution tailored for real estate investors, especially those seeking funding for investment properties in competitive markets like Denver. Unlike traditional bank loans, hard money loans are provided by private lenders and are often based on the value of the underlying property rather than the borrower’s creditworthiness. This makes them accessible to both seasoned investors and newcomers looking to purchase, rehabilitate, or hold investment properties in Denver.

In the vibrant real estate landscape of Denver, investment property loans can be a game-changer for prospective buyers. Lenders specializing in hard money lending offer quicker funding processes compared to conventional lenders, allowing borrowers to seize market opportunities promptly. These loans are typically short-term, ranging from 12 to 36 months, and come with fixed interest rates, providing borrowers with predictability and control over their financial obligations. Understanding the nuances of hard money lending can empower investors to make informed decisions when navigating Denver’s competitive real estate market.

The Benefits of Hard Money Loans for Investment Properties

properties

Hard money loans, especially tailored for investment properties, offer a range of benefits that make them an attractive option for real estate investors in Denver and beyond. These loans are designed to provide quick access to capital, enabling investors to seize immediate opportunities in the competitive market. With flexible terms and less stringent requirements compared to traditional banking options, hard money lenders cater to various borrower needs. This is particularly advantageous for those looking to purchase, rehabilitate, or flip investment properties rapidly.

One of the key advantages lies in the streamlined approval process, often taking just a few days, allowing investors to secure funding swiftly. Additionally, hard money lenders typically provide customized loan amounts based on the property’s value, offering higher borrowing power than conventional loans. This feature is invaluable for investors aiming to maximize their purchasing potential. Furthermore, these loans offer a fixed interest rate and clear repayment terms, providing borrowers with financial predictability and control over their investments.

How to Qualify and Apply for an Investment Property Loan in Denver

properties

Qualifying and applying for an investment property loan in Denver is a straightforward process when you know where to start. First, assess your financial health by reviewing your income, assets, and credit score. Lenders typically require a minimum credit score of 600-650 for investment property loans, so ensure yours falls within this range. Additionally, prove your ability to make consistent monthly payments by demonstrating stable employment and verifiable income sources.

When applying, gather essential documents such as tax returns, bank statements, and proof of residency. Select a reputable lender who specializes in investment property loans in Denver and browse their website for application instructions. Fill out the form accurately, providing detailed information about your desired property and intended use. Lenders may also require additional documentation, so be prepared to supply anything requested promptly to expedite the approval process.
